S&P 500 Sector ETFs: Opportunities and Risks in a Dynamic Market
S&P 500 industry ETFs present both intriguing opportunities and inherent risks for investors navigating the dynamic landscape of today's financial markets. By utilizing these funds, investors can obtain diversified exposure to specific sectors within the broad S&P 500 index, allowing them to customize their portfolios based on economic conditions and investment objectives.
However, it is essential for investors to carefully analyze the risks associated with sector-specific ETFs. These funds are often more susceptible to niche trends and economic fluctuations, which can lead to higher volatility compared to broader market indicators.
Before committing capital to S&P 500 Sector ETFs, investors should perform a comprehensive review of the underlying holdings, risk ratios, and historical results. Moreover, staying informed about current market conditions and niche trends is essential for making informed investment decisions.
